3. Popular Types of Sand Toys
There is a wide variety of sand toys available to suit every age group and interest. Some popular types include:
H1 Heading: Shovels and Buckets
Shovels and buckets are classic sand toys that form the foundation of any sandcastle-building adventure. They come in different sizes and shapes, allowing you to dig, scoop, and transport sand effortlessly.
H2 Heading: Sand Molds and Forms
Sand molds and forms are perfect for creating intricate shapes and designs. From castles and animals to cars and trucks, these molds help bring imaginations to life.
H2 Heading: Sand Rakes and Sieves
Sand rakes and sieves are ideal for refining sandcastle details and sifting out unwanted debris. They make it easier to create smooth surfaces and intricate patterns.
H1 Heading: Water Toys
Water toys designed for sand play add an extra element of fun. These toys include water wheels, sprayers, and squirters that can be used to create water channels and enhance the overall play experience.

7. Safety Considerations for Sand Play
While sand play is generally safe and fun, it's essential to consider a few safety precautions. Ensure the sand area is free from sharp objects or debris that may cause injury. Encourage children to wash their hands before and after playing to maintain hygiene. Also, be cautious of the sun's harmful rays and apply sunscreen regularly.
8. Tips for Cleaning and Maintaining Sand Toys
Proper cleaning and maintenance of sand toys ensure their longevity and hygiene. Rinse the toys with clean water after each use and allow them to dry thoroughly. For toys with hard-to-reach crevices, a gentle scrub with a brush can help remove stubborn sand particles. Regularly inspect the toys for any signs of damage and replace them if necessary.

10. Sand Toys for Sensory Play
Sand play provides a rich sensory experience, engaging multiple senses simultaneously. The texture, temperature, and weight of the sand stimulate the tactile sense, while the sound of pouring sand activates the auditory sense. Sand toys that incorporate different textures, colors, and shapes can further enhance the sensory play experience.
11. Educational Value of Sand Toys
Sand play offers numerous educational benefits. It promotes scientific exploration as children observe the effects of water and sand on different structures. Counting, sorting, and classifying activities with sand toys can enhance math and problem-solving skills. Sand play also encourages language development and storytelling as children describe their creations.
12. Sand Toys for Toddlers and Preschoolers
Sand toys are suitable for children of all ages, including toddlers and preschoolers. Look for toys specifically designed for their smaller hands and developing motor skills. These toys often feature rounded edges and chunky handles for easy grasping.
